Len Goodman "recovering well" after skin cancer surgery

Former Strictly Come Dancing head judge Len Goodman has had a successful operation to remove a skin cancer growth from his forehead.

The 76-year-old, who appeared on the BBC ballroom show between 2004 and 2016, is thought to have had the surgery earlier this month and requires no further treatment.

"Len is recovering well," a source told The Sun. "It was obviously a shock but he didn't waste any time in getting it treated.

"He is now urging fans to wear sun lotion, especially as the weather has been so hot, and to check any moles they're worried about with a doctor."

The newspaper says that Goodman has been in the UK during coronavirus lockdown, casting doubt on whether he will return to his job on Dancing With The Stars, which begins in the US on September 14.
